Output f84c23e2f23652609637d4c31596452aad17d401e37fd1d744fd1e48a8b40af3:1

value
1504326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10a8080da6148794c35d801e95a3848f8ad67223 OP_EQUAL
address
33D62eGn5DcirFF8sMsGoC6TnPxV9e3wX5
transaction
f84c23e2f23652609637d4c31596452aad17d401e37fd1d744fd1e48a8b40af3
spent
true